+uint8_t USB_Host_GetDeviceStatus(uint8_t* const FeatureStatus)
+{
+       USB_ControlRequest = (USB_Request_Header_t)
+               {
+                       .bmRequestType = (REQDIR_DEVICETOHOST | REQTYPE_STANDARD | REQREC_DEVICE),
+                       .bRequest      = REQ_GetStatus,
+                       .wValue        = 0,
+                       .wIndex        = 0,
+                       .wLength       = 0,
+               };
+
+       Pipe_SelectPipe(PIPE_CONTROLPIPE);
+
+       return USB_Host_SendControlRequest(FeatureStatus);
+}

+uint8_t USB_Host_GetInterfaceAltSetting(const uint8_t InterfaceIndex,
+                                        uint8_t* const AltSetting)
+{
+       USB_ControlRequest = (USB_Request_Header_t)
+               {
+                       .bmRequestType = (REQDIR_DEVICETOHOST | REQTYPE_STANDARD | REQREC_INTERFACE),
+                       .bRequest      = REQ_GetInterface,
+                       .wValue        = 0,
+                       .wIndex        = InterfaceIndex,
+                       .wLength       = sizeof(uint8_t),
+               };
+
+       Pipe_SelectPipe(PIPE_CONTROLPIPE);
+
+       return USB_Host_SendControlRequest(AltSetting);
+}
